Bootcamp error quitting unexpectedly

I am trying to install Windows 10 from ISO file on my macbook pro 2016 but after installing windows support softwares and creating the partition; it says that bootcamp is quitting unexpectedly


Please help.

MacBook Pro with Retina display, macOS Sierra (10.12.2)

We can bypass BC Assistant and you can manually install Windows using the USB. Creating USB installer is fairly straightforward.


From the OS X side, use BC Assistant and the Action -> Download... option to download BC drivers for your Mac. Copy the entire contents of the ISO to this USB. This is your USB Installer.


Create a FAT32 partition using Disk Utility. Now you can boot from the the USB using Alt/Option, choose the FAT32 partition, format it as needed, and instal Windows. If you run into any issues, please post any error messages.

There are two partitions on 2015 and later Macs, which get used.


OSXRESERVED - contains the BC drivers and contents of the ISO. This is a replacement for the traditional USB installer.

FAT32 partition - this is the designated Windows destination which is formatted after being selected from FAT32 to NTFS before installation starts.


Now, which partition is not being created?
